Description

This Birdhouse was one of my first bigger prints on my Creality CR10s. I printed it for my mothers birthday in 2018. Since then it is hanging in her garden and the birds love it!

I printed it in PLA and sealed it with vanish and it is still completly intact. You can fill the Birdfood (kernels, corns,…) into the top, while it is hanging and it falls out to the sides into a tray, where smaller birds can feed from it. It also prevents bigger birds from stealing the food, because they can't land anywhere.

You could also print the six side panels, however I decided to make them from Acrylic Glass. You need to cut 7x12,5 big squares out of 4 mm thick Acrylic glass. I would suggest test fitting the pieces. After that you press fit the upper ring over the Panels, so they can't move (There are tolerances for bad cutting too :)), I never had a house where you could see the cuts). The last step is to make a knot into a rope and slide it thru the middle hole. The hole should be sealed for the Food not to fall thru. 10mm to 12mm rope will be perfect. I also made some with smaller, but woven together rope. After that you can attach the houses to a tree.

This Model prints on all Bambu-printers (beside A1 mini)!!!!
